The Quillhaven catalogue importer ingests MARC-style records in batches and reconciles duplicates against the existing shelf index. Because upstream feeds from the Bramblewood consortium arrive in bursts, the importer throttles itself rather than relying on database backpressure. These limits were chosen after profiling a full 1.2M-record import on staging, and the release build must ship with them unchanged. The tuning constants are as follows.

tuning constants:
RATE_LIMITS = {
    "ralwyn": 5,
    "zorael": 2,
}

Subject: On-call handover — build agent clock skew

Hi Priya-team,

Handing over the clock skew issue on the Copperline build agents. Agents 4 and 7 drifted roughly 90 seconds ahead this week, causing intermittent signature-validation failures on artifact uploads. I restarted the time-sync daemon on both, which held for about a day before drift resumed, so the root cause is likely the hypervisor layer. Infra is aware and tracking it. For hypervisor-side questions, reach the platform virtualization group directly.

escalation mailbox, bafog-fafog: ulador@paliqlabs.internal

Ticket: First-aid room restock and access check — Ledmore Court, ground floor. The first-aid room beside reception has been restocked following last week's audit; the burns kit and eyewash station were both replaced, and expiry labels updated. Reception staff should direct anyone needing treatment to this room and record the visit in the logbook on the counter. The door now locks automatically when closed. To admit someone, reception staff should use the keypad code below.

door code, tahop-fahap: bdg-JZCXMY-37375484